Title: Housing Assistance for Low Income Residents in Suisun City Heading 1: Suisun City Housing Authority's Assistance Programs The Suisun City Housing Authority plays a vital role in providing housing assistance to low-income residents through the management of the Housing Choice Voucher Program, commonly known as Section 8. This income-based program aims to alleviate the housing burden of eligible individuals and families. Heading 2: Eligibility and Application Process Determining eligibility for the Housing Choice Voucher Program is based on the guidelines set by the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D). These requirements ensure that the limited resources are allocated to those who need it most. It's important to note that due to the high demand for housing assistance in the area, there may be occasional waiting lists or temporary closures to new applications. Heading 3: Contact and Information If you find yourself in need of housing assistance, we encourage you to reach out directly to the Suisun City Housing Authority. Their knowledgeable staff is available to provide you with detailed information about program eligibility, the availability of assistance, the status of waiting lists, and application procedures. You can conveniently visit their office at City Hall during the following hours: - Monday, Wednesday, and Thursday: 8:00am - 6:00pm - Tuesday: 8:00am -7:00pm
701 Civic Center Blvd, Suisun City, CA 94585
